Title
Shunt-mounted harmonically-tuned power rectifier for distributed power converters

Abstract
An RF power rectifier has been designed, constructed in surface-mount technology, and evaluated for use in distributed power converters for advanced electronic packaging applications. With commercially available components, a 40-W rectifier with a 100-MHz input from a 50- Omega source impedance provides 2.9-V output with 38% conversion efficiency. Detailed simulation and characterization indicates that 50-W and 10-W converters are capable of 70% and 80% conversion efficiency, respectively, with low-loss RF implementations.<>
